- In the past week, 196,800 tons of grain were exported from the Russian port of Novorossiysk (+65% compared to the previous week), including 164,800 tons of wheat and 32,000 tons of corn. Wheat was sent to Iran and Turkey, and corn to Libya.

- Over the period of 01.07.2021 - 23.05.2022, 34.15 million tons of wheat were exported from Russia (-11% compared to the previous year). The total grain export is 38.5 million tons (-20%). By the end of the season (June 30), another 850,000 tons of wheat will be exported. Barley exports and corn exports are 40% below last year's levels.

- Russia Grain Union expects grain exports from Russia to reach 40 million tons in 2021/22 and the quota for wheat to be fully met. In 2022/23, the total grain production will be 128 million tons, including 85 million tons of wheat.

- Spring barley areas in Ukraine reach 926,000 hectares, which is 35% less than the previous year, according to the Ukrainian Grain Association. Total barley areas reached 1.85 million hectares (-20%).

- MARS expects an average yield of soft wheat in the EU in 2022/23 of 5.89 tons/hectare (-1% compared to the previous estimate and -2% compared to 2021/22). The average yield of winter barley is estimated at 5.78 tons/hectare (-0.2% and -5%). The average corn yield is projected at 7.92 tons/hectare (7.91 in the previous estimate), and the average rapeseed yield will be 3.19 tons/hectare (-0.6%).

- According to data from FranceAgriMer, as of 16.05.2022, 73% of winter wheat crops are in good and excellent condition in France (82% a week earlier and 79% a year earlier). The decline is due to prolonged drought. 71% of the winter barley crops (77% and 68%) and 69% of the spring barley crops (76% and 84%) are in good and excellent condition. The sowing campaign of corn has been completed on 98% of the planned areas (+7% and 97%).

- As of May 22, 2022, 49% of the planned areas in the United States have been sown with spring wheat, which is the lowest level for the last 20 years.

- On Friday, commodity funds in Chicago were net sellers of 10,500 contracts of wheat and 5,500 contracts of soybeans and net buyers of 4,000 contracts of soybeans. On Monday, commodity funds were net buyers of 5,000 corn contracts and 9,000 wheat contracts and net sellers of 8,000 soybean contracts.

- In their May report, analysts from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ada raised their forecast for the wheat production in Canada in 2022/23 by 0.4 million tons to 31.6 million tons (21.7 in 2021/22). Wheat xports are expected at 21.9 million tons (+0.3 compared to the previous forecast, 15.3 in 2021/22 and 26.3 in 2020/21). Domestic consumption will reach 8.4 million tons (-0.4 compared to 2021/22) and ending stocks are expected to reach 5 million tons (-1.4).

- In April, 6.3 million tons of soybeans were imported from Brazil to China (+120% compared to March and 5.08 in April 2021). 1.64 million tons of soybeans (3.37 and 2.15) were delivered from the United States to China in April. In the first 4 months of the year, soybean imports to China were 12.7 million tons from Brazil (6.42) and 15 million tons from the United States (21.27). Since the beginning of March, the margin of Chinese soybean processors has fallen sharply to -282 yuan/ton.

- In March, a record 857,800 tons of canola were exported from Australia, which is 41% more than in February - 608,500 tons (748,900 tons in March 2021). The largest customers were Belgium with 193,700 tons, Germany with 183,200 tons, France with 147,800 tons and the Netherlands with 123,200 tons. Over the period of January - March, exports amounted to 2.1 million tons (538,600 throughout October - December).

- Indonesia does not plan to reduce the blending of the biocomponent in biodiesel, which is now 30%. The aim is to ensure the country's energy security. In the event that oil prices fall, then a shift of up to 20% is possible.

- The Indonesian authorities will introduce mandatory sales of some products on the domestic market in order to meet the consumption of 10 million tons of palm oil. This will happen after the lifting of the export ban on 23.05.2022.

- According to government data, wheat stocks in Egypt are sufficient enough to cover domestic consumption for 4.1 months.
